Parallel reading
البحل أهمله الجوهري والليث
Al-Buḥal was neglected by Al-Jawhari and Al-Layth.
وقال ابن الأعرابي: هو الإدقاع الشديد
And Ibn Al-A'rabi said: It is intense stubbornness.
رواه أبو العباس عنه
Abu Al-Abbas narrated it from him.
قال الأزهري: وهذا غريب
Al-Azhari said: And this is strange.
ونقله الصاغاني أيضا في كتابيه
And Al-Sagani also transmitted it in his two books.
